What Common Problems Can Arise with Aftermarket 4L60E Transmissions?

Common problems that can arise with aftermarket 4L60E transmissions include:

  • Incompatibility Issues: Aftermarket 4L60E transmissions may not be compatible with all vehicle models or engine configurations, leading to installation challenges or functionality problems.
  • Quality Variance: The quality of aftermarket parts can vary significantly, with some components being less durable or reliable than OEM parts, potentially causing premature failures.
  • Improper Calibration: Aftermarket transmissions may require specific tuning or calibration to work correctly with the vehicle’s engine and computer system, and failure to do so can result in shifting issues.
  • Warranty Limitations: Many aftermarket transmissions come with limited warranties that may not cover certain types of damage or failure, placing the burden of repair costs on the owner.
  • Installation Errors: Incorrect installation by inexperienced mechanics can lead to a host of issues, including leaks, improper alignment, or failure to connect to other vehicle systems.

Incompatibility issues often arise when the aftermarket transmission is not designed for a specific vehicle or engine type, which can lead to unexpected performance problems. This can manifest as poor shifting, unusual noises, or even complete failure to engage.

The quality variance in aftermarket transmissions means that while some brands may offer high-performance parts, others might use inferior materials or manufacturing processes, which can result in components wearing out faster than expected. This inconsistency can be a gamble for vehicle owners looking for budget-friendly options.

Improper calibration is another frequent problem, as aftermarket transmissions may not work seamlessly with the factory’s electronic control unit (ECU). Without the correct tuning, drivers might experience hard shifts, slipping, or even failure to shift altogether, leading to poor driving experiences.

Warranty limitations are crucial to consider since many aftermarket products come with restrictive warranties that may not cover certain types of failures, especially if the product is modified or improperly installed. This lack of comprehensive coverage can lead to significant out-of-pocket expenses for repairs.

Finally, installation errors can be a significant issue, especially if the technician lacks experience with aftermarket products. Mistakes made during the installation process can lead to leaks, misalignment, or failure to integrate properly with the vehicle’s existing systems, ultimately compromising the transmission’s performance and longevity.

What Performance Enhancements Can You Expect from Upgrading to an Aftermarket 4L60E Transmission?

Upgrading to an aftermarket 4L60E transmission can significantly improve performance and reliability in your vehicle.

  • Increased Torque Capacity: Aftermarket 4L60E transmissions are designed to handle higher torque levels, making them suitable for modified engines or vehicles used for towing. This enhancement ensures that the transmission can withstand the stresses of increased power without premature failure.
  • Improved Shift Quality: Many aftermarket options come with upgraded valve bodies and solenoids that enhance the precision and speed of shifts. This results in smoother transitions between gears, which can improve overall driving experience and responsiveness.
  • Enhanced Durability: Aftermarket transmissions often utilize stronger materials and better construction techniques compared to stock versions. This translates to a longer lifespan, especially under high-stress conditions like racing or heavy towing.
  • Customizable Options: Many aftermarket manufacturers offer transmissions with customizable features, such as adjustable shift points and firmness settings. This allows drivers to tailor the transmission’s performance to their specific driving style or vehicle needs.
  • Better Cooling Systems: Upgraded aftermarket 4L60E transmissions frequently include improved cooling systems, which help maintain optimal operating temperatures. This is crucial for preventing overheating during heavy use, thus prolonging the transmission’s life and reliability.
  • Higher Gear Ratios: Some aftermarket transmissions provide the option for different gear ratios, which can optimize performance for specific applications, such as off-roading or drag racing. This flexibility can enhance acceleration and overall vehicle dynamics.
